The island was inhabited as far back as the Mesolithic Period and came under Celtic influence during the Iron Age. It had a turbulent history and came under the rule of the Norse in 1079 but in 1266, Norway's King Magnus VI ceded the island to [[Scotland]]. The Isle of Man came under English control in the fourteenth century.

The head of state of the Isle of Man is the head of state of the [[United Kingdom]], who holds the title of '''Lord of Mann''' and is represented on the island by a '''Lieutenant Governor'''. The country's government, '''Tynwald''', thought to have been founded in 979, is one of the oldest established governments in Europe.
